Fashion in a pop video is normally a key aspect
|
D
|
In my pop video I used the stereotype of a geek played on
her fashion, styling her with big glasses, and a chequered shirt. There is a
scene where the artists friend transforms her into a typical teenage girl.
|
|
The actors and singers in a pop video are usually
teenagers
|
U
|
In my video, the cast are all teenagers; schoolboys and
schoolgirls. This develops the playfulness and young feel to the song
‘popcorn boy’ as well as the genre
|
|
Most of the time pop videos involve bright colours with
the scenery and costumes
|
U
|
I used the idea of bright colours in my pop video with the
scenery in the background, especially when filming in school. This made the
visuals more interesting and particular people stand out more. The outfit of
the ‘popcorn boy’s’ football kit also stool out due to the contrasting bold
colours of red and white. This brought the audiences attention to him in that
particular scene.
|
|
Occasionally, pop videos include dance routines and strict
formations
|
C
|
In ‘popcorn boy’ we used dance where the main artist could
freestyle while she sung. However, we did not have a strict dance routine as
we thought that was more suitable for a pop group rather than a solo artist.
We also felt choreographing a dance and teaching it to the cast would be too
time consuming.
|
|
In general, pop videos portray relationships and
friendships through the characters.
|
D
|
My music video develops this convention by highlighting
the boy trouble the main artist is having. Instead of portraying teenage love
in a positive way, the music video shows a troubled relationship. The close
up shots of other characters and the dressing table scene show friendship and
socializing between each other.
|
|
Pop music videos frequently use the camera to visualise
the female body in a provocative way
|
C
|
In my pop video, I did not use the camera to visualise the
female body in a provocative way as it was not suitable. However, we used
many close up shots and actions of the ‘popcorn boy’ to enhance his over
confident character.
|
|
More often than not, pop videos are up beat and reflect in
the camera work and movement in the video
|
U
|
‘Popcorn boy’ is a lively music video with a variety of
different shots involving many different actions. This highlights the up beat
sound track how the shots quickly cut between each other. One shot involves
the pop corn boy kicking a football in time to the beat. This adds to the
relationship between the song and visuals.
|
|
Many pop videos include close up and extreme close ups
|
U
|
In the ‘popcorn boy’ music video there are a variety of
different shots. However, many consist of close ups and extreme close ups.
The close up shots help to enhance the cheerful and up beat emotions while the
extreme close up shots tend to highlight the innocence and purity of the
personalities of the characters.

A striking image of the artist is a key aspect in a
Pop advert
|
D
|
I developed this convention by using a bold, striking
image of my artist and changing the opacity in order to merge with the
background of the pink, fluffy clouds. This creates an innocent approach to
the advert.
|
|
A capturing theme. Example: colour, atmosphere,
styling.
|
U
|
I used this convention by creating a theme of the
colour pink. This helps portray the girly and teenage personality of ‘Tig’,
which is more attracting to the teenage target audience. It also highlights
the pop genre, as it is playful.
|
|
Pop adverts usually include a quote from a popular
magazine aimed at teenagers.
|
U
|
I included a quote from a pop magazine “Cosmo Girl”
aimed at young teenage girls. Researched showed that Cosmo Girl’s target
audience was similar to Tig’s herself, therefore it was a suitable review.

Pop digi pak’s usually consider a theme
that develops through each side
|
D
|
My digipak has a clear background colour
of pink through the lockers, clouds and American flag. This highlights the
strong feminine aspect of Tig and helps attract the young teenage target
audience. I included a pink, sketched heart in every side forming Tig’s
signature icon.
|
|
Images of the artist are more likely to
be playful and happy
|
U
|
I used this convention by using playful
and confident images of Tig with happy facial expressions. This reflects the pop
genre to an extent as the majority are upbeat and cheerful
|
|
Digi paks always have a record label that
promotes their artist which is suitable for their genre
|
U
|
I incorporated this convention within my
digi pak using the record label ‘universal’ that promotes similar young, pop artists
such as Carly Rae Jepsen and Demi Lovato
